The investigation is focusing on the basic problem, if the brand placement in the movie “Mission Impossible – Ghost Protocol” was a wise investment.
Research question: Did the product placement in the latest "Mission Impossible" movie increase the purchase intention of BMW branded cars?
Hypothesis: If the brand image and the image of the movie fit well then the purchase intention increases.
Primary research: Questionnaire with application of the Semantic Differential

Frequently Asked Questions
What is brand placement in movies?
Brand placement is the integration of branded products or services into a film's narrative to reach a target audience in a non-traditional way.
Did BMW's placement in "Mission Impossible" increase sales?
The research investigates whether the placement in "Ghost Protocol" increased the purchase intention of consumers by fitting the brand image with the movie's image.
What is a Semantic Differential questionnaire?
It is a psychometric tool used to measure consumer perceptions of a brand by asking them to rate it between opposing adjectives (e.g., modern vs. traditional).
What are the different categories of brand placement?
Placements can be categorized as barter arrangements (product for screen time), gratis (free), or paid placements.
